Автор Тема: Автоматично монтиране на CD-ROM  (Прочетена 1342 пъти)

varbancho

  • Напреднали
  • *****
  • Публикации: 61
    • Профил
Здравейте. Имам един много досаден проблем със CD-ROM-a под Мандрейк 10. Преди като сложа диск в цд-рома линукса го монтираше автоматично и на десктопа се повявяваше линк към /mnt/cdrom. Един хубав ден направих ъпдейт на ядрото (до 2.6.7) и тази екстра изчезна... Сега трябва ръчно да монтирам и демонтирам устройството. На всичко отгоре когато искам да инсталирам някой пакет от Mandrake Control Center -> Software Management -> Install, програмата не може да разпознае диска и го вади. Във fstab имам следното:

Примерен код

/dev/hda3 / reiserfs notail 1 1
none /dev/pts devpts mode=0620 0 0
none /mnt/cdrom supermount dev=/dev/hdc,fs=auto,ro,exec,--,umask=0,user,iocharset=iso8859-1,codepage=855,noauto 0 0
none /mnt/floppy supermount dev=/dev/fd0,fs=auto,--,umask=0,user,iocharset=iso8859-1,codepage=855,noauto,owner 0 0
/dev/hda1 /mnt/win_c ntfs umask=0,nls=cp1251,ro 0 0
/dev/hda5 /mnt/win_d ntfs umask=0,nls=cp1251,ro 0 0
none /proc proc defaults 0 0
/dev/hda4 swap swap defaults 0 0


Някой знае ли как мога да спася положението?  '<img'>
Активен

sdr

  • Напреднали
  • *****
  • Публикации: 655
    • Профил
Автоматично монтиране на CD-ROM
« Отговор #1 -: Aug 02, 2004, 08:35 »
supermount или нещо от сорта ... отдавна сам се замислил дали не може да се пачне ядрото за да се прекара нотификацията за вкарване изкарване на ЦД-то през системата за хотплъг мааааааа
Активен

spawnman

  • Напреднали
  • *****
  • Публикации: 455
    • Профил
Автоматично монтиране на CD-ROM
« Отговор #2 -: Aug 02, 2004, 15:02 »
Ето как са при мен нещата:
- във fstab:

/dev/hdc /mnt/cdrom auto umask=0,user,iocharset=iso8859-1,codepage=850,noauto,ro,exec 0 0

-в настройките на КДЕ:

ConfigureDesktop... -> Behavior -> Device Icons -> имам кръстче на Show Device Icons и отметка на Mounted CD-ROM

Така настроени нещата работят при мен с Мандрейк 10 Official Release.
Активен

Mandriva Cooker
BlackBox

FV80503200 SL27J, 82437FX TSC, 128 (4x32) MB 72pin EDO, AHA-2940UW, ST34572W, M2513A, CDU521, CTL0024, 3C509b-TPC, 215R3PUA22, FP767-12

savel

  • Напреднали
  • *****
  • Публикации: 52
    • Профил
Автоматично монтиране на CD-ROM
« Отговор #3 -: Aug 05, 2004, 00:37 »
ако си сложил официалното ядро от kernel.org е нормално ,
то няма supermount

другата възможност е да се е сменило името на cd-то(/dev/hdc)
..
Активен

varbancho

  • Напреднали
  • *****
  • Публикации: 61
    • Профил
Автоматично монтиране на CD-ROM
« Отговор #4 -: Aug 05, 2004, 10:56 »
Наистина използвам официалното ядро, явно е от това... А как може да се оправи без да сменям ядрото?

//Добавка....
Намерих нещо по въпроса тук, има пач и за ядро 2.6.7.
Активен

kolio_kolev

  • Напреднали
  • *****
  • Публикации: 356
  • Distribution: Mandriva 2011, Mandriva Cooker
  • Window Manager: KDE 4.6.x
    • Профил
    • WWW
Автоматично монтиране на CD-ROM
« Отговор #5 -: Aug 05, 2004, 12:21 »
С кое ядро си в момента ? Ако си с 2.6.7 - пробвай този http://rpm.pbone.net/index.p....pm.html
Mandrake винаги правят пакети с новите ядва , дори и с RC версиите, така че те съветвам да си вземаш направо техните пакети...
Активен

Кольо Колев
Mandriva BG: http://mandriva.biotronica.net
Bitronica.Net форуми: http://forum.biotronica.net

varbancho

  • Напреднали
  • *****
  • Публикации: 61
    • Профил
Автоматично монтиране на CD-ROM
« Отговор #6 -: Aug 05, 2004, 14:20 »
Благодаря, ще го пробвам. '<img'>

PS. A и още едно въпросче: кой е по-добрия вариант - да инсталирам готовото комилирано ядро, или да си го компилирам сам?
Активен

spawnman

  • Напреднали
  • *****
  • Публикации: 455
    • Профил
Автоматично монтиране на CD-ROM
« Отговор #7 -: Aug 07, 2004, 23:40 »
Изглежда най-добър вариант е първо да сложиш компилираното ядро и ако нещо не ти хареса да си го компилираш сам  '<img'>
Активен

Mandriva Cooker
BlackBox

FV80503200 SL27J, 82437FX TSC, 128 (4x32) MB 72pin EDO, AHA-2940UW, ST34572W, M2513A, CDU521, CTL0024, 3C509b-TPC, 215R3PUA22, FP767-12

varbancho

  • Напреднали
  • *****
  • Публикации: 61
    • Профил
Автоматично монтиране на CD-ROM
« Отговор #8 -: Aug 08, 2004, 01:12 »
И аз така си мислех '<img'>, обаче се появи един малък проблем. От по-горния линк дръпнах два файла: kernel-2.6.7.2mdk-1-1mdk.i586.rpm и kernel-2.6.7.2mdk-1-1mdk.src.rpm.  Първия ми е ясно, че е компилираното ядро, за втория си помислих, че е сорс кода, но се оказа, че не е съвсем така. При опит да го инсталирам с rpm -ivh <име> не се получава нищо (в /usr/src няма нищо)...
Разгових се в гугъла и намерих, че за този архив трябва да се ползва rpmbuild --rebuild <име.src.rpm>, което обаче започва да компилира ядрото и направи .rpm файл. Има ли начин от kernel-2.6.7.2mdk-1-1mdk.src.rpm да получа сорс кода на ядрото?
Активен

  • Гост
Автоматично монтиране на CD-ROM
« Отговор #9 -: Aug 08, 2004, 02:20 »
Не си чел достатъчно, а аз не помня достатъчно - имаше опция, която ти "изважда" сорса от тоя пакет.
Виж man rpmbuild
Активен

savel

  • Напреднали
  • *****
  • Публикации: 52
    • Профил
Автоматично монтиране на CD-ROM
« Отговор #10 -: Aug 09, 2004, 18:26 »
дръпни си kernel-source-2.6.7... пакета
Активен

doom

  • Напреднали
  • *****
  • Публикации: 14
    • Профил
Автоматично монтиране на CD-ROM
« Отговор #11 -: Dec 06, 2005, 23:17 »
уф, да! И аз имам такъв проблем, само че под SuSE 8.2! Откакто си смених CD-ROM-a не мога да си инсталирам пакетите от дисковете! Иначе разпознава CD-ROM-a  ... ':angry:'
Активен